Athlon CPU does not overclock well and it can't handle demanding games well . Even if you had it overclocked to 3.4GHz , you would still have slowdown from time to time
Xenoblade is one of those demanding games ( The Last Story , MHTri , Mario Galaxy , Padora's Tower ... )
Your GPU is the beast but your CPU is just ...too slow and outdated . In other word , your CPU bottleneck the GPU

I noticed noone has posted any pics of xenoblade with eyefinity, i got hold of a second monitor and spent a few minutes trying it out, and it was awesome, apart from the thick black bezel between the monitors Sad

Anyways i took a few pics and you can see them on picasa:
https://picasaweb.google.com/108792592991292582189/XenobladeEyefinity?authuser=0&authkey=Gv1sRgCImI-bXa5JHYWA&feat=directlink


Incase anyone wants to do this, for 30fps on xenoblade with 2by1 eyefinity you will need a 3570k OCd to around 4.2-4 (mines at 4.5) and also i would recommend atleast a radeon hd 7850 2GB (1GB wont cut it for eyefinity). I will be getting a third monitor soon but my 7850 can handle 3840X1080 and 4xAA so I reckon it should be able to handle 3x1 eyefinity and 2xAA.

IR was at 3840x1080
Aspect Ratio was set to stretch (screws up GUI like hell in some games)
Used OpenGL, seems to give a bit more performance and also the 2xAA is a nice option instead of 4xAA
